Summary
This chapter describes the interactions between three-dimensional fuel metrics, intrinsic fuel properties, plant functional traits, and physical characteristics of fuels that inform a new understanding of fire and vegetation feedbacks. The integration of these themes introduces a new synthetic model of fire–vegetation feedbacks. Interrelated concepts of fire, fluid flow, functional traits, and computational fluid dynamics fire behavior models are discussed within the synthetic model framework.

This SHEA white paper identifies knowledge gaps and challenges in healthcare epidemiology research related to coronavirus disease 2019 (COVID-19) with a focus on core principles of healthcare epidemiology. These gaps, revealed during the worst phases of the COVID-19 pandemic, are described in 10 sections: epidemiology, outbreak investigation, surveillance, isolation precaution practices, personal protective equipment (PPE), environmental contamination and disinfection, drug and supply shortages, antimicrobial stewardship, healthcare personnel (HCP) occupational safety, and return to work policies. Each section highlights three critical healthcare epidemiology research questions with detailed description provided in supplementary materials. This research agenda calls for translational studies from laboratory-based basic science research to well-designed, large-scale studies and health outcomes research. Research gaps and challenges related to nursing homes and social disparities are included. Collaborations across various disciplines, expertise and across diverse geographic locations will be critical.

In recent years, a variety of efforts have been made in political science to enable, encourage, or require scholars to be more open and explicit about the bases of their empirical claims and, in turn, make those claims more readily evaluable by others. While qualitative scholars have long taken an interest in making their research open, reflexive, and systematic, the recent push for overarching transparency norms and requirements has provoked serious concern within qualitative research communities and raised fundamental questions about the meaning, value, costs, and intellectual relevance of transparency for qualitative inquiry. In this Perspectives Reflection, we crystallize the central findings of a three-year deliberative process—the Qualitative Transparency Deliberations (QTD)—involving hundreds of political scientists in a broad discussion of these issues. Following an overview of the process and the key insights that emerged, we present summaries of the QTD Working Groups’ final reports. Drawing on a series of public, online conversations that unfolded at www.qualtd.net, the reports unpack transparency’s promise, practicalities, risks, and limitations in relation to different qualitative methodologies, forms of evidence, and research contexts. Taken as a whole, these reports—the full versions of which can be found in the Supplementary Materials—offer practical guidance to scholars designing and implementing qualitative research, and to editors, reviewers, and funders seeking to develop criteria of evaluation that are appropriate—as understood by relevant research communities—to the forms of inquiry being assessed. The anticipated release of EnlistTM cotton, corn, and soybean cultivars likely will increase the use of 2,4-D, raising concerns over potential injury to susceptible cotton. An experiment was conducted at 12 locations over 2013 and 2014 to determine the impact of 2,4-D at rates simulating drift (2 g ae ha−1) and tank contamination (40 g ae ha−1) on cotton during six different growth stages. Growth stages at application included four leaf (4-lf), nine leaf (9-lf), first bloom (FB), FB + 2 wk, FB + 4 wk, and FB + 6 wk. Locations were grouped according to percent yield loss compared to the nontreated check (NTC), with group I having the least yield loss and group III having the most. Epinasty from 2,4-D was more pronounced with applications during vegetative growth stages. Importantly, yield loss did not correlate with visual symptomology, but more closely followed effects on boll number. The contamination rate at 9-lf, FB, or FB + 2 wk had the greatest effect across locations, reducing the number of bolls per plant when compared to the NTC, with no effect when applied at FB + 4 wk or later. A reduction of boll number was not detectable with the drift rate except in group III when applied at the FB stage. Yield was influenced by 2,4-D rate and stage of cotton growth. Over all locations, loss in yield of greater than 20% occurred at 5 of 12 locations when the drift rate was applied between 4-lf and FB + 2 wk (highest impact at FB). For the contamination rate, yield loss was observed at all 12 locations; averaged over these locations yield loss ranged from 7 to 66% across all growth stages. Results suggest the greatest yield impact from 2,4-D occurs between 9-lf and FB + 2 wk, and the level of impact is influenced by 2,4-D rate, crop growth stage, and environmental conditions.

Numerous studies have examined relationships between disease biomarkers (such as blood lipids) and levels of circulating or cellular fatty acids. In such association studies, fatty acids have typically been expressed as the percentage of a particular fatty acid relative to the total fatty acids in a sample. Using two human cohorts, this study examined relationships between blood lipids (TAG, and LDL, HDL or total cholesterol) and circulating fatty acids expressed either as a percentage of total or as concentration in serum. The direction of the correlation between stearic acid, linoleic acid, dihomo-γ-linolenic acid, arachidonic acid and DHA and circulating TAG reversed when fatty acids were expressed as concentrations v. a percentage of total. Similar reversals were observed for these fatty acids when examining their associations with the ratio of total cholesterol:HDL-cholesterol. This reversal pattern was replicated in serum samples from both human cohorts. The correlations between blood lipids and fatty acids expressed as a percentage of total could be mathematically modelled from the concentration data. These data reveal that the different methods of expressing fatty acids lead to dissimilar correlations between blood lipids and certain fatty acids. This study raises important questions about how such reversals in association patterns impact the interpretation of numerous association studies evaluating fatty acids and their relationships with disease biomarkers or risk.

Significant new opportunities for astrophysics and cosmology have been identified at low radio frequencies. The Murchison Widefield Array is the first telescope in the southern hemisphere designed specifically to explore the low-frequency astronomical sky between 80 and 300 MHz with arcminute angular resolution and high survey efficiency. The telescope will enable new advances along four key science themes, including searching for redshifted 21-cm emission from the EoR in the early Universe; Galactic and extragalactic all-sky southern hemisphere surveys; time-domain astrophysics; and solar, heliospheric, and ionospheric science and space weather. The Murchison Widefield Array is located in Western Australia at the site of the planned Square Kilometre Array (SKA) low-band telescope and is the only low-frequency SKA precursor facility. In this paper, we review the performance properties of the Murchison Widefield Array and describe its primary scientific objectives.

The report on partial rescue excavations of the Collfryn enclosure between 1980–82 presents a summary of the first large-scale investigation of one of the numerous semi-defensive cropmark and earthwork enclosure sites in the upper Severn valley in mid-Wales. Earlier prehistoric activity of an ephemeral nature is represented by a scattering of Mesolithic and Late Neolithic or early Bronze Age flintwork, and by a pit containing sherds of several different Beaker vessels. The first enclosed settlement, constructed in about the 3rd century bc probably consisted of three widely-spaced concentric ditches, associated with banks of simple dump construction, having a single gated entranceway on the downhill side. It covered an area of about 2.5 ha and appears to have been of a relatively high social status, and appropriate in size for a single extended-family group. This was subsequently reduced in about the 1st century bc to a double-ditched enclosure, by the recutting of the original inner ditch and the cutting of a new ditch immediately outside it. The habitation area between the 3rd and 1st centuries bc probably focused on timber buildings in the central enclosure of about 0.4 ha, whose gradually evolving pattern appears to have comprised between 3–4 roundhouses and 4–5 four-posters at any one time. Little excavation was undertaken between the outer ditches of the first phase settlement, but these are assumed to have been used as stock enclosures. A mixed farming economy is suggested by cattle, sheep/goat and pig remains, and remains of glume wheats, barley and oats. Industries included small-scale iron and bronze-working. The Iron Age settlement was essentially aceramic, although there are significant quantities of a coarse, oxidized ceramic probably representing salt traded from production centres in the Cheshire Plain. The entranceway was remodelled in about the late 1st or early 2nd, century AD by means of a timber-lined passage linked to a new gate on the line of the inner bank. There is equivocal evidence of continued occupation within the inner enclosure continuing until at least the mid-4th century AD, possibly at a comparatively low social level, associated with domestic structures of uncertain form sited on earlier roundhouse platforms, and including some four-posters and possible six-posters. Drainage ditches were dug across parts of the site during the Medieval and post-Medieval periods, which were associated with various structures, including a corn-drying kiln inserted into the inner enclosure bank in the 15th century.
